Hi is anyone experiencing that the font-size parameter on css doesn't affect the views on Splunk 6? Or its just me. I'm currently applying my custom css for views I can see splunk can load my css but the font-size parameter is not working for me. Put the css files on the proper location still font-size parameter not working. Is it just me?

Use a browser such as Firefox which allows you to perform element inspection. It will show you how CSS is being applied. It is possible element/class names have changed or been augmented and that your CSS is being ignored or over-ridden.

Did you ever find a solution to this question?

I am trying to increase the font size of the single-value result to be bigger than the default of 24px. I have used Firefox/Firebug to inspect the element of a single value result. I can see values being over-ridden (they are crossed out in Firebug) from bootstrap.min.css, dashboard-simple-bootstrap.min.css, and application.css, and the one that remains comes from "mgs" (which is the name of the dashboard), and sets the font size to 24px. I have set the font size parameter to a value other than 24 in all .css files I can find underneath the Splunk directory. I can see these changed values being registered (in Firebug), but 24px still continues to be selected at the end. I have also reset the font size for single-result from 24px to something else (mostly 23px) everywhere else I can find it (including other .css files, .js and .less files). But the single value result font remains at 24px. Are there any other suggestions for what to try?

Similar questions have been asked before, and answers indicated that the syntax of the CSS changed between Splunk versions 4 and 5, and I think version 6 is different again. So those previous answers are not helping with the solution for Splunk 6.

Yes I did manage to change the font-size of the single values. I added the !important tag. Here's my sample css

.row-textinputheader .single-value .single-result {
color: #FFF;
font-size: 42px !important;
}
